The situation is now slightly different. We are able to use ktimer_* facilities, it only remains to support CLOCK_THREAD_CPUTIME_ID, CLOCK_PROCESS_CPUTIME_ID and clock_id's created by clock_getcpuclockid() and pthread_getcpuclockid()
http://pubs.opengroup.org/onlinepubs/9699919799/functions/pthread_getcpuclockid.html http://pubs.opengroup.org/onlinepubs/9699919799/functions/clock_getcpuclockid.html The kernel support is available in HEAD (but not in STABLE-9). It could be easier to backport (kernel part of) http://www.freebsd.org/cgi/query-pr.cgi?pr=16841 into our kernel.
